Starlight has had a history of being in the spotlight, often attending superhero events as a child, she is selected to be a member of The Seven after interviewing following Lamplighter's retirement. To achieve said objective, she would force Annie to participate in dancing contests, such as "little miss hero pageant".Įarly Career Season One Joining The Seven The guilt would eventually make him leave both his wife and daughter.ĭespite losing her husband, Donna would continue to train her daughter so that she could become a famous superhero one day. When she would ask about the origins of her powers, her parents would lie and tell her that God gave them to her, further reinforcing her faith in Christianity.ĭespite Donna and her husband both agreeing to turn Annie into a supe, Annie's father would come to regret his decision due to the guilt of having to lie to his daughter. Afterwards, Annie would be groomed by her parents to become a superhero and would grow up in a hyper-religious home. Desiring for their child to be special, Annie's parents decided to take Vought's offer to injected with Compound V and be turned into a supe. The Boys Series Background Childhood Īnnie January was born somewhere around 1996-1997 as the only child of Donna January and an unnamed man. However, that dream becomes her worst nightmare when this fresh-faced Midwesterner arrives in New York and learns that the old adage is true: never meet your heroes. So, when she's selected to join The Seven, it's every dream she's ever had come true. And as Starlight, "The Defender of Des Moines", all she's ever wanted to do is save the world - and while a lot of people say that as a corny catchphrase, she actually means it. Serving as the tritagonist of both Season 1 and Season 2, and the deuteragonist of Season 3.Īnnie January is as down-to-earth and sincere as they come, the girl next door with superpowers.
